Output ce39d8fb92c094b10ea85b7dbfadaee7ca027563166efed30c3af7d3571d41f7:1

value
9838991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680e091e6b4406d911f7cec5667d26fd446ea479 OP_EQUAL
address
3BBD1hue8nbeH4dHg7ZU6tMCiyUEuy7u7C
transaction
ce39d8fb92c094b10ea85b7dbfadaee7ca027563166efed30c3af7d3571d41f7
confirmations
171607
spent
true